Thomson Reuters logo

Software Engineer

Thomson Reuters

Eagan, MN
Full Time
Mid Level
70k-130k
15 days ago

Job Description

About the Role

The Software Engineer - CIAM role is part of the Platform Engineering organization at Thomson Reuters, responsible for building and maintaining the Customer Identity & Access Management (CIAM) Platform. This platform consolidates and replaces multiple identity systems with a secure, high-availability, cloud-based, standards-driven solution to manage customer authentication and authorization across all Thomson Reuters products. The role involves developing cloud-native applications, collaborating across teams, and working with identity standards and cloud platforms to support the company's core services.

Key Responsibilities

  • Participate in all aspects of the development lifecycle including ideation, design, build, test, and operation.
  • Emphasize test and deployment automation using various commercial and open source tools.
  • Collaborate with technologists across the company to build cloud native applications.
  • Develop REST APIs using Java or .NET core.
  • Ensure projects align with cloud architectural guiding principles.
  • Maintain extreme transparency and collaboration with all product teams.
  • Participate in Scrum teams and embrace an agile work model.
  • Keep up to date with emerging cloud technology trends, especially in identity access management and open source/cloud vendors such as AWS and Azure.

Requirements

  • Interest in Identity Management.
  • Excellent problem-solving skills to identify and resolve complex technical issues.
  • Experience developing REST APIs using Java or .NET Core.

Nice to Have

  • Bachelor's degree in a related technology program.
  • Experience with a major Identity Provider such as Ping, Okta, or Auth0 for workforce or customer identity and access management.
  • Experience with automation and CI/CD tools using CloudFormation, Terraform, or GitOps.
  • Experience developing cloud native applications and services on Azure, AWS, or GCP.
  • Familiarity with identity management solutions using OAuth2, OIDC, SAML, or SCIM.

Qualifications

  • Bachelor's degree in a related technology field (preferred).
  • Experience with identity providers like Ping, Okta, or Auth0.
  • Experience with automation and CI/CD tools such as CloudFormation, Terraform, or GitOps.
  • Experience with cloud native application development on Azure, AWS, or GCP.
  • Knowledge of identity management standards like OAuth2, OIDC, SAML, or SCIM.

Benefits & Perks

  • Hybrid Work Model with flexible in-office days.
  • Flexibility & Work-Life Balance policies including work from anywhere for up to 8 weeks per year.
  • Career Development and Growth programs.
  • Industry competitive benefits including flexible vacation, mental health days, retirement savings, tuition reimbursement, and wellbeing resources.
  • Culture emphasizing inclusion, belonging, and work-life balance.
  • Social Impact initiatives with paid volunteer days and community projects.
  • Comprehensive US benefits including health, dental, vision, disability, life insurance, 401k with match, paid holidays, parental leave, sabbatical, and additional optional benefits.

Working at Thomson Reuters

Thomson Reuters fosters a culture of continuous learning, inclusion, and innovation. The company values transparency, collaboration, and a strong commitment to social impact and community involvement. It emphasizes flexible work environments, professional growth, and a mission-driven approach to providing trusted content and technology that helps professionals and institutions make informed decisions and uphold justice, truth, and transparency.

Apply Now

Job Details

Posted AtJul 12, 2025
Salary70k-130k
Job TypeFull Time
Work ModeHybrid
ExperienceMid Level

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About Thomson Reuters

Website

thomsonreuters.com

Company Size

10000+ employees

Location

Eagan, MN

Industry

Newspaper Publishers

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ches